Difficulty - 16307, Total Network Hashing - 120 Ghash Per Sec

Earlier today the Difficulty threshold for generating Bitcoin went from 14484 to 16307.  The difficulty readjusts every 2,016 blocks and today this happened today at block 10,800.

This puts the hashing strength of the entire Bitcoin network at roughly 120 Ghash/s.  While it is difficult to compare this performance to the levels that supercomputers provide, or to that found in other distributed computing projects, Bitcoin''s hashing growth rate is likely unparalleled for projects of this size.

At the end of the day, this means that my share of the network has dropped and it is taking longer and longer to generate a block.  To see more regular payouts, one option is to join the mining pool.  Or to start looking at more hardware.
